What Does It Mean to Tune a Car Stereo?
Tuning a car stereo means adjusting the settings on your head unit (and amplifier, if you have one) so the sound coming from your speakers is balanced, clear, and free of distortion. This includes setting gain levels, equalizer (EQ) bands, fader, balance, and crossover points. It’s different from simply turning up the volume — a poorly tuned system can sound worse the louder it gets, while a properly tuned car stereo can sound clean even at higher volumes.
Most drivers never touch these settings beyond the factory defaults. But if you’ve added an aftermarket head unit, amplifier, subwoofer, or new speakers, tuning becomes important because factory presets are rarely built for your exact combination of gear.
Why Tuning Your Car Stereo Matters
A well-tuned system protects your speakers from damage caused by distortion, improves clarity for music, podcasts, and calls, and makes long drives more comfortable. Vehicle cabins are noisy and irregularly shaped, which affects how bass, midrange, and treble frequencies reach your ears. Learning how to tune a car stereo for your specific vehicle interior — not just for the equipment itself — often makes the biggest audible difference.
Improperly set gain is one of the most common causes of blown speakers and damaged amplifiers, because it’s frequently confused with a volume control. Setting it correctly is one of the most important safety-adjacent steps in the entire tuning process.
How It Works in Practice
Most factory and aftermarket head units offer some combination of a graphic or parametric EQ, a fader/balance control, and crossover settings. If you have an external amplifier, gain is usually set separately on the amp itself, not the head unit’s volume knob. Bluetooth and USB audio sources typically feed the same processing chain as radio or AUX input, so tuning a car stereo generally applies across all of your audio sources, not just one.
Compatible Vehicle and System Types
Older vehicles with basic factory radios usually offer only bass, midrange, treble, and fader — simple but still useful to adjust. Newer vehicles with digital head units or premium factory audio brands often include multi-band EQ, subwoofer level, and speed-sensitive volume settings. Aftermarket setups with a separate amplifier add gain staging as an extra step that factory-only systems don’t need.

Step-by-Step: How to Tune a Car Stereo
Follow this order every time you tune a car stereo. Doing steps out of order — especially setting EQ before gain — is one of the most common reasons DIY tuning sounds off.
Reset everything to flat/zero. Set all EQ bands, bass, treble, and gain to their neutral or lowest starting point. This gives you a clean baseline instead of tuning on top of old, unknown settings.
Center the fader and balance. Set fader to front/rear center and balance to left/right center so sound is even before adjusting anything else.
Set gain if you have an amplifier. With the head unit volume around 75% and no EQ boost, slowly raise amp gain until distortion just appears, then back it off slightly. Gain is not a volume control — it sets the amp’s input sensitivity.
Set crossover points. If you have separate speakers or a subwoofer, set high-pass and low-pass crossover frequencies so each speaker only plays the range it handles best.
Adjust EQ by ear with familiar music. Use a song you know well. Make small adjustments to bass, midrange, and treble rather than large jumps, listening for balance rather than maximum bass or treble.
Balance subwoofer level. If you have a subwoofer, adjust its level so bass supports the music without overpowering vocals or midrange.
Test-drive and re-check. Road and engine noise change how a system sounds, so re-listen while driving on a familiar route and make small final adjustments once parked safely.

In practice, following this order prevents the common mistake of chasing bass or treble with EQ before gain is set correctly, which can mask distortion instead of fixing it.
Note: Some digital head units and DSP units include a built-in test tone or auto-tune feature. These can be a useful starting point, but manual fine-tuning by ear after auto-tune usually still improves the final result.
Safety and Electrical-Care Considerations
Most tuning is done through software menus and doesn’t involve touching wiring. However, some steps overlap with electrical safety, especially if you’re accessing an amplifier or checking wiring while tuning a car stereo with an aftermarket system.
Safety Note: Never adjust settings, reach for controls, or lean toward an amplifier while driving. Park safely first. If your amplifier is mounted near the battery, trunk wiring, or fuse box, avoid touching bare wiring, and disconnect the battery’s negative terminal before inspecting connections if anything feels loose or exposed.
Distortion at high gain settings isn’t just uncomfortable to listen to — it can overheat voice coils in speakers and subwoofers over time. Setting gain correctly, and avoiding maximum volume with a heavily boosted EQ, is one of the simplest ways to protect your equipment while you tune a car stereo for daily use.

Pro Tips: What Experienced DIYers Check
Experienced car audio DIYers rarely rely on EQ alone. They check gain first with a proper method, verify crossover points match actual speaker specs instead of guessing, and always confirm settings during a real drive rather than only while parked. Beginners often skip the “listen while driving” step, missing how road and engine noise change perceived balance.

Frequently Asked Questions
How often should I tune a car stereo?
Most drivers only need to tune a car stereo once after installing new equipment, then re-check settings occasionally or after any new speaker or amp changes.
Do I need special tools to tune a car stereo?
No special tools are required for basic tuning by ear. A multimeter or SPL meter app can help with more precise gain setting but isn’t essential for most factory or basic aftermarket systems.
What’s the difference between gain and volume?
Volume controls how loud the head unit’s output signal is, while gain sets how sensitive the amplifier is to that signal. Using volume alone to compensate for low gain can cause distortion and speaker stress.
Can I tune a car stereo through Bluetooth or USB audio too?
Yes. Most head units apply the same EQ, fader, and crossover settings across radio, Bluetooth, and USB sources, so tuning generally covers all your audio inputs at once.
Why does my system distort even at low volume?
This is usually caused by gain being set too high relative to the head unit’s output. Reset gain using the distortion-then-back-off method described in this guide.
Should I tune my car stereo myself or hire a professional?
Basic tuning through head unit menus is safe for most DIYers. If tuning involves accessing wiring, rewiring an amplifier, or the system ties into factory electronics, a qualified professional installer is the safer choice.
Will tuning a car stereo void my warranty?
Adjusting factory menu settings typically doesn’t affect warranty coverage, but modifying wiring or installing aftermarket components might. Check your vehicle’s warranty terms before making permanent changes.
